Angela Cibelli

Angie trained with the L.A. Dance Theatre, Inc. where she was a featured soloist both competitively and in theatrical productions.   She has performed in stage productions such as “West Side Story” and the “Nutcracker” in which she appeared as “Clara” and “Sugar Plum Fairy”. While competing as a soloist with the L.A. Dance Theatre, she won multiple talent titles such as “Miss Performing Arts” and a scholarship to be applied to tuition at Alvin Ailey Dance Theatre.  The criterion for both awards was well-rounded, technical talent.  Angie continued dancing and exploring as a choreographer at West Chester University. At this time she also performed for “Under the Sun Productions” making appearances in the Sunoco Welcome America Parade, JCC Macabbi Games, Fairmont Waterworks Gala, and Good Morning America. Angie has since continued teaching dance in area schools Phoenixville H.S., St. Maximillan Kolbe, and West Chester University.
